Output ef91cb0a1e24ce6b4020aa97e9c5e8ceff99f344d741811035dd9ab6f0977a74:3

value
333188257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c068c693e71a4ce357791a5d74bd8002d234b557 OP_EQUAL
address
MRSXVCpBDhHGnevtNaKgcGmZxx9x6d24qD
transaction
ef91cb0a1e24ce6b4020aa97e9c5e8ceff99f344d741811035dd9ab6f0977a74
spent
true